If many … WebThat means that exceptions are transaction specific, and are based on the status of the title, and the nature of the transaction creating the estate or interest insured. Exceptions are shown on Schedule B of title commitments (in order to show the exceptions that will be in the policy) and in Schedule B of the final policy.
